Код
program pr2;
uses CRT;
const
n = 10;
type
TMass = array[1..10] of integer;
var
a : TMass;
i, sum, max : integer;
begin
clrscr;
{ Инициализируем генератор }
randomize;
sum := 0;
writeln('Массив: ');
for i:=1 to n do
begin
a[i]:=random(10);
write(a[i]:4);
{ Считаем сумму элементов }
{ для среднего арифметического }
sum := sum + a[i];
end;
max := a[1];
{ Ищем максимум }
for i:=2 to n do
begin
if max < a[i] then max := a[i];
end;
write('Результат: ', max - (sum / n));
readln;
end.
uses CRT;
const
n = 10;
type
TMass = array[1..10] of integer;
var
a : TMass;
i, sum, max : integer;
begin
clrscr;
{ Инициализируем генератор }
randomize;
sum := 0;
writeln('Массив: ');
for i:=1 to n do
begin
a[i]:=random(10);
write(a[i]:4);
{ Считаем сумму элементов }
{ для среднего арифметического }
sum := sum + a[i];
end;
max := a[1];
{ Ищем максимум }
for i:=2 to n do
begin
if max < a[i] then max := a[i];
end;
write('Результат: ', max - (sum / n));
readln;
end.
P.S. Pascal ABC 3.0.1.35